A rather listless 0-0 tie vs. Australia today, in a conservatively played game that neither team needed to win.

Scoring chances were few and far between. Alex Morgan had an early breakaway but her shot went right at the keeper's chest. Later in 1H she appeared to score on a header, but she was slightly offside. Australia had a header chance of its own, off a US defensive miscue, but hit the crossbar. The second half was downright boring as neither team took chances.

US finishes 2nd in group and advances to play a quarterfinal against Group F winner Netherlands, in a rematch of the 2019 WC final. Netherlands has scored an amazing 21 goals in its 3 games, including 8 by their star striker Miedema. But they've have also given up 8 goals, so their defense is far from impenetrable.
